November 29, 20214 yr Following lots of help and advice from Forum Members over the last few days (on another Post here) I've now bought MSFS. I have a Saitek Cyborg 3D USB joystick that works very well in a host of other Sims (inc: DCS - Il2 Cliffs of Dover, - Wings over Flanders + also 3rd Reich. - X-Plane - FSX - P3D & trusty old FS9) It also works as expected in the Windows 10 Calibration graphics, and also the set-up Graphics in the MSFS program. Unfortunately when I go into the Sim, it is so erratic when operated (seemingly uncontrolled movements - in the correct sense for the aircraft control but erratically) that it makes control of the aircraft impossible I am aware of the 'tuning' possible within the Sim. (altering the curves etc.) Is there something I'm missing please or is it just a case of me not yet getting the adjustments correct? Your observations would be much appreciated. Regards, Blue
November 29, 20214 yr One thing I found with my controller was that the default assignements had two functions linked to one control which meant if I pressed that control (in my case the rudder) the plane did a massive jiggle. In the controller settings in the sim one of the filters allow you to see just the assigned controls. I would go into the sim and have the filter set to that and then see what controls are assigned and watch for duplicates. CJ

November 29, 20214 yr If you used FSUIPC in any of your other sims, you may want to revisit this app here, if you find that the MSFS control setup does not work for you. Plan A: do what was suggested above... it should work. Plan B: FSUIPC7 allows you to move all controller assignments out of MSFS and set them up in a familiar environment.
